Donald A. Eicher passed away Thursday, January 28, 2021. He was born May 15, 1935 to Violet (Graham) and Robert Lee Eicher in Toledo, Ohio. He attended McKinley Grade School and Macomber High School where he served on student council. He played football and was the captain of the team. He made all city from 1951-1953 and all north team in 1953 and elected class president the same year. Don was elected to the Macomber High School Sports Hall of Fame. Don was a 32 degree Mason in Damascus-Collingwood Lodge #643 F. & A.M. and was a past Master and a 32 degree Scottish Rite. He was a member of York Rite in Fort Meigs Lodge Chapter #29 F. & A. M. , Toledo Council, Toledo Commandery, Zenobia Shrine, Zenobia Patrol where he was a past secretary, treasurer, vice president, president and served as captain general. He was also a member of Jester Court #21 and past president. On June 1, 1957, he married the love of his life Carol Lea Reichard and to this union were born son, Scott Allan (Debbie) Eicher; twin daughters, Denise Marie (Gino) Watkins and Dawn Elizabeth Greenwood who survive. Also surviving are his five grandchildren, Samuel Watkins, Nicholas Sturner, Zac, Jacob, Max Greenwood; great grandchildren, Micah Watkins, Kasen Sturner, Warrick Greenwood and two great grandsons on the way.
